Abstract

A head gimbal assembly includes a suspension including a suspension flexure. The suspension flexure includes a step plate mechanically formed in the suspension flexure. A micro-actuator is mounted to the step plate of the suspension flexure. The step plate is constructed and arranged to support the micro-actuator such that a substantially constant gap is maintained between a top support of the micro-actuator and the suspension flexure in use.
